WebDec 2, 2016 · Duke Ahn, M.D. (Board Certified in Orthopaedic Surgery) Monday - … WebThe anterior approach utilizes a natural interval between muscles on the front of your hip to gain access to the hip joint. Because no muscles or tendons are cut and the posterior capsule remains intact the inherent stability of the joint is maintained. This removes the need for hip precautions following an anterior total hip replacement. WebThe anterior hip recovers very naturally, with walking, simple home exercises, and … auto nissan pk usate

WebHip Precautions after Total Hip Replacement Posterior Surgery Do not turn your surgical leg inward. Don’t let your surgical knee or foot point toward your other leg. Don’t turn your body towards your surgical leg. Do not cross your legs. Imagine a line that divides you into left and right sides. Do not let your legs cross that line.

WebSee Post-Surgical Hip Replacement Precautions and Tips For example, people who have traditional hip replacements are told not to bend at the hip more than 90 degrees for about 6 weeks. This precaution makes it challenging to sit on low chairs, sofas, or toilets. Anterior hip replacement patients do not have to follow this precaution.
